Parents' Childhood

Thomas Mills was born in 1816 to William and Catherine Mills in Culcheth, Cheshire, England.

Ann Clegg was born in 1818 to William and Ann Clegg in Leigh, Greater Manchester, England.

Thomas and Ann Mills in England

Thomas and Ann lived in Leigh and had 15 children there.

At the time of Ann's death, the younger children were: Samuel, age 19; Rebecca, age 17; Robert, age 15; Ann, age 14; and Eliza, age 11.

The Mills family was closely connected to the Hones—Jane and Rebecca would marry two of their sons, and Robert would marry one of their granddaughters. Mary and her husband traveled to Utah on the same ship as the Hones.

Thomas and Sarah Mills in Utah

Thomas immigrated to Utah in 1874 with his children Ellen, Rebecca, Robert, Ann, and Eliza. He married Sarah Cashmore just a few months later.

Sarah was an English widow with three surviving children: Ellen Bithell (age 18, just married months before), Sarah Kidgell (age 10), and Fredrick Kidgell (age 2). Thomas brought four teenagers to the mixed family: Rebecca, Robert, Ann, and Eliza.

Rebecca and Ellen married in Utah. Ellen was Josiah Arrowsmith's second polygamous wife. They lived in Provo. She died soon after giving birth to her first child.

Thomas and Sarah divorced after just two years of marriage, in 1877. Sarah would remarry and lived with her third husband in Salt Lake City.

Thomas and Mary Mills

A few months later, Thomas married Mary Olesen. They had two children together.

Mary was an immigrant from Denmark. Thomas was her fifth husband:

  • In 1860 she married Christen Plougmann in Denmark. They had two children, Catherine and Anders. Christen probably died in Denmark.
  • In 1864 she married Moses Shepherd in Utah. She was his third polygamous wife. They had one child, Rhoda. Moses died in 1866.
  • About 1867, she married David Davis, his second wife. They had three children: Morris, Annie, and Lydia. David died in 1873.
  • About 1874, she married a Mr. Tryon. More research is needed to document this marriage.

At the time of her marriage to Thomas, Mary had 5 unmarried children: Anders Ploughman (about age 16), Rhoda Shepherd (age 11), Morris Davis (age 9), Annie Davis (age 7), and Lydia Davis (age 6). Thomas's unmarried children were Robert Mills (age 19), Ann Mills (age 17), and Eliza Mills (age 15).

The family appears to have settled in Benjamin, Utah around this time.

Thomas and Mary were together about 8 years before he died. Mary died in Benjamin 7 years later.

Descendants

Martha, George, Nephi, and Samuel remained with their families in Leigh. Nephi died young, and his only child died soon after.

The rest of Thomas and Ann's children immigrated to Utah:

  • Mary and her family settled in Benjamin.
  • Jane and her family also settled in Benjamin; after their children were grown, she and her husband retired in Payson.
  • After Ellen's death, her daughter was raised in Provo.
  • Rebecca and her husband remained in Benjamin.
  • Robert and his family lived in Benjamin.
  • Ann and her family lived in Benjamin, and later moved to Provo.
  • Eliza and her family lived in Benjamin, and later moved to Burley, Idaho.

Among Thomas and Mary's children:

  • Lydia married three times and settled with her children in northern California.
  • Thomas William died a few years after his mother's death, at about age 18.
